Factors Influencing Emergency Situation Oral Expenses



When considering emergency situation oral expenses, different aspects can dramatically affect the last amount you may have to pay. One vital aspect is the seriousness of your dental issue. Small problems like a cracked tooth might set you back less contrasted to a much more complicated emergency situation like an origin canal.

The timing of your emergency situation can additionally affect the price. Looking for assistance throughout regular office hours may be more economical than needing instant interest outside of common functioning hours.

Your area plays a role as well. Urban areas often tend to have higher dental prices than rural areas as a result of differences in overhead expenses. The details dentist you choose can additionally impact the last bill. More knowledgeable or specific dental experts might charge greater charges for their solutions.

In addition, the requirement for any diagnostic tests, medicines, or follow-up appointments can contribute to the total cost.

To take care of emergency dental expenditures, it's vital to know these variables and think about looking for treatment promptly to stop additional problems that might boost the last bill.

Common Emergency Dental Procedures and Costs



Emergency situation dental solutions typically include procedures such as removals, dental fillings, and root canals, each with differing linked prices. Extractions, where a tooth is removed, can range from $75 to $450 per tooth depending on the intricacy. Fillings, used to treat cavities, typically cost between $100 to $300 per filling. Origin canals, a procedure to deal with contaminated tooth pulp, might range from $500 to $1500 per tooth.

For cracked teeth, the price can vary from $100 to $1000 relying on the seriousness. Dental crowns, made use of to cover broken teeth, generally expense between $500 and $3000 per tooth. Fixing a fractured tooth might range from $100 to $1000.

Bear in mind that these expenses can change based on elements like the dental professional's know-how, place, and the intricacy of the procedure. Comprehending the potential prices of typical emergency oral procedures can much better prepare you for managing unanticipated oral expenditures.

Tips for Handling Emergency Situation Dental Costs



To better navigate unanticipated oral costs, take into consideration implementing useful strategies for managing emergency dental expenses efficiently. To start with, see to it to have dental insurance policy or a dental cost savings plan in position. These options can help reduce the economic concern of emergency treatments.



In addition, some dental professionals provide internal funding or layaway plan, which can make it much easier to cover the prices with time.
